Description
Studio portrait of three soldiers. One is known to be 2474 Private (Pte) John Lawrence Fitzgerald, 5th Reinforcements, 21st Battalion, of Gippsland, Vic. Pte Fitzgerald enlisted on 15 July 1915 and embarked from Melbourne aboard HMAT Osterley on 29 September 1915. On 19 July 1916, whilst serving with the 59th Battalion, he was killed in action at Fleurbaix, France. His brother, 3312 Lance Corporal Daniel Fitzgerald, 59th Battalion, was wounded at Polygon Wood, Belgium, and died on 5 October 1917.
